2008 Honda Jazz vs. 2004 Proton Gen-2
To start off, 2008 Honda Jazz is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Proton Gen-2.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Proton Gen-2 would be higher. At 1,597 cc (4 cylinders), 2004 Proton Gen-2 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Proton Gen-2 (109 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 27 more horse power than 2008 Honda Jazz. (82 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Proton Gen-2 should accelerate faster than 2008 Honda Jazz.
Let's talk about torque, 2004 Proton Gen-2 (148 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 29 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Honda Jazz. (119 Nm @ 2800 RPM). This means 2004 Proton Gen-2 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Honda Jazz.
